Output 585c0aa608119395725ef25071b995c1c80fea8d527f06f89b493b4e18cc8a6d:3

value
23427905
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b567578a23b9acd84cc3bd1df066003c66849946 OP_EQUALVERIFY OP_CHECKSIG
address
1HYB73fgfdRyJqCp1c46gkq4MiFvfEospE
transaction
585c0aa608119395725ef25071b995c1c80fea8d527f06f89b493b4e18cc8a6d
spent
true